Lambretta Malaysia Outlines 2026 Plan — New Models, Bigger Dealer Network, Merchandise… and a Record Attempt

At a recent gathering, Lambretta Malaysia unveiled a broad 2026 programme that included the launch of new models, a nationwide expansion of dealer and service network, introduction of an exclusive merchandise line, more community events, as well as an attempt to set an ASEAN / Asia record at the Petronas Sepang International Circuit.

What the Company Announced
Bike Continent Sdn Bhd, the official distributor of Lambretta, said the 2026 programme builds on the brand’s relaunch in Malaysia in July 2024 and recent sales momentum. The plan aims to broaden Lambretta’s presence across Peninsular Malaysia and to make the brand more accessible through more showrooms, service points and pop-up experiences.

New Models and Dealer Network Expansion
Lambretta Malaysia is planning to introduce two to five all-new models in 2026. The company said these scooters will combine modern technology with distinctive Lambretta styling, and are intended to meet growing demand from urban commuters, lifestyle riders and collectors.
To support sales and ownership, Bike Continent plans to grow its physical footprint to about 15–20 locations nationwide by the end of 2026, including full flagship outlets, dedicated service points and regional pop-ups. Target areas named in the release include Kuala Lumpur, Penang, Johor Bahru, Melaka, Pahang and Kelantan.

Community, Merchandise and Events
To cater to a growing group of enthusiasts, the company will launch an exclusive Lambretta merchandise collection in 2026 — apparel and lifestyle items inspired by the brand’s heritage — to be sold through official channels. It also plans a calendar of community activities: group rides, workshops, customization contests and cross-border rallies with neighbouring ASEAN clubs to strengthen local and regional Lambretta communities.

Sepang Record Attempt and Casa Lambretta Malaysia
A headline event for the year is an official record attempt at Sepang on 11 January 2026, for the largest gathering of Lambrettista staged as part of the Casa Lambretta Malaysia launch. The day is planned to include full-track Lambretta rides, exhibitions, live entertainment and record-keeping activities. The launch of Casa Lambretta Malaysia is described as a dedicated hub for authentic parts, accessories and heritage displays — positioned as both a service and community focal point.
“We’ve seen a surge in demand from urban commuters, lifestyle riders, and collectors alike, solidifying Lambretta’s position as a premium scooter brand in Malaysia,” said Ronnie Chen, Managing Director, Bike Continent Sdn Bhd.
